How to Create a Crimped Side Part Hairstyle?
Depending on the final look that you desire, you should use clean and dry hair for this type of hairstyle. Start with the deepest side part possible as this will form the basis for the rest of the style. A rat-tail comb or your fingers should be used to divide your hair into sections appropriately. Depending upon your preference, you can go deep on the side for a more effective look. If you want more volume, there’s one rule to follow: style the hair on the opposite side of the part.
Then, to crimp your hair, you can use the crimping iron or if you don’t have it you can use a flat iron with a crimping comb attachment. I advise starting with the smaller parts and gradually passing the crimping iron through the sections applying the same amount of pressure to achieve the same size of the crimp. In case you don’t have the crimping iron, then this is the next best thing you can do to achieve the crimped look; braid your hair in smaller sections and let it stay like that overnight. After crimping all sections, you can gently rake fingers through the hair to make the texture look softer and set hair with a light-hold hairspray.

Tips for Styling the Crimped Side Part Hairstyle
Choose the Right Tools for Crimping
Another important aspect, which shall be of great importance in the sense of effective crimped side parts, is in the selection of equipment to use. There are special crimping irons for this purpose, although one can use absolutely any irons, the size of the plates can vary, being small or large, depending on the texture and volume of the hair you want to get. Other straightening tools can also be used in making crimps though the heat setting must be adjusted appropriately; pressure for crimping must also be adjusted appropriately to achieve well-defined and consistent crimps. In case you want a natural look you can use heatless hairstyles such as plaiting your hair or using rollers.
Add Volume and Texture
Crimped hair itself has a lot of texture the side part compliments very well as the hair is full at the crown area. If you’d like to achieve maximum volume, simply turn your hair in the opposite direction of the part when the first crimping starts. This gives more volume to the roots, thus making a general impression of fullness and vitality. If you need to create more defined waves, you might use some texturizing spray or mousse before crimping to improve the result – your hair would be stronger and more voluminous.

Maintain and Protect Crimped Hair
However, crimped hair if done with heat tools is prone to dry and damaged hair if not well managed. It is also important to use heat product spray before crimping as it has a lot of effect in damaging the hair. And also remember that you need to use moisturizing shampoos and conditioners so that hair keeps on being soft and healthy. After that shower, it is followed by the serum or leave-in conditioner to minimize all the frizz and give the crimped hair that shiny look.

FAQs
Can I create a crimped side part without a crimping iron?
However, would you like to know how you can fashion a crimped side part without using a crimping iron? One simple way to braid your hair is to do so in small strands and leave them overnight. This will give you a crimped wave appearance when you decide to lose the twists or braid. If not, you can use a straightener with a little bit of a turn or a curling wand for the same result.
How can I keep my crimped side part from getting flat throughout the day?
To avoid your crimped side part falling, use hairspray that has a stronghold or even use a texturizing spray. After crimping, a small tug at each root would help to magnify the effect further, excluding touching your hair throughout the day.
